Abstract

The present invention relates to an exhaust sensor (1) comprising a tubular support body (2) receiving a measurement probe (3), a first end of said probe extending beyond a first end of the tubular support body through an opening therein, and a second end of said probe being secured to an electrical connection connector (4) housed inside the tubular support body (2) and fitting closely against its walls. According to the invention, the measurement probe is sealed inside the tubular support body (2) and is thermally decoupled from the environment outside the tubular support body by means of an assembly of spacers (10, 11, 12, 13) made of ceramic and of glass, the spacers being threaded around the measurement probe and distributed inside the tubular support body between the electrical connection connector and the first end of the tubular support body so as to provide at least two separate cavities, said spacers providing leaktight sealing between the measurement probe and the tubular support body.
